โญ Honey (Best Dairy-Free Option)
1:1 (1 cup honey per 1 cup maple syrup)Honey works well because it has a similar sugar concentration and viscosity to maple syrup, which helps maintain the moisture and texture of quick bread. The natural sugars in honey caramelize during baking, contributing to a golden crust and pleasant flavor.
When substituting honey, reduce other liquids slightly to compensate for its higher moisture content. Also, lower the oven temperature by 25ยฐF to prevent over-browning due to honey's higher sugar content.
The final bread will have a slightly different flavor profile, with a more floral and less caramel-like taste, but the texture and moisture will be very close to the original recipe using maple syrup.
